I applied online. The process took 7 weeks. I interviewed at Amazon in Jun 2021
Interview
Interview process was in 3 steps, initial interview with recruiter, then hiring manager, then panel of 5 interviewers and 5 interviews. (not counting the writing assessment or aptitude assessment)
First two steps are quite straight forward, description of personnel profile and job requirements.
With the hiring manager, questions will be based on Amazon principle (1 in my case).
The final step is more challenging.
All 5 interviewers are going to discuss one leadership principle. In my case, all were focused on one or two principles.
It is good to be prepared, and have different examples (STAR).
For the bar raiser, be prepared to dive deep into the example.
Interview questions [1]
Question 1
based on leadership principle of Amazon -
Tell me a time you improved a process that didn't need improving (bar raiser)
Tell me of your best accomplishment
Tell me what you are most proud about
Tell me of a situation you had to solve a complex problem without all information
Tell me about an innovation that you made
Tell me a time you had to help a colleague
